  • Indian government proposes Index of Services Production (ISP) to track services sector.
  • Services sector contributes over 50% of India's Gross Value Added (GVA).
  • ISP expected to cover about 70% of GVA of services.
  • Data sources include Annual Survey of Incorporated Services Sector Enterprises (ASISSE) and GST.
  • Challenges include standardizing indicators due to sector diversity and informality.
